Metodologia de realizare a bazelor de date

Curs
8/10 (1 vot)
Conține 1 fișier: doc
Pagini : 13 în total
Cuvinte : 3918
Mărime: 29.69KB (arhivat)
Publicat de: Janina Ene
Puncte necesare: 0
Profesor îndrumător / Prezentat Profesorului: I. Lungu

Extras din curs

3.1. Organizarea unei baze de date

Activitatea de realizare a unei baze de date trebuie să înceapă cu organizarea acesteia, adică pregătirea acţiunii. În cadrul acestei pregătiri, ţinând cont de obiectivele urmărite pentru realizarea bazei de date, se va face un fel de inventar a ceea ce este un minim necesar pentru a se putea realiza baza de date. Se poate astfel, din start, hotarî dacă activitatea va demara imediat sau dacă mai sunt necesare alte acţiuni pregătitoare.

Prezentăm, în continuare, câteva aspecte mai importante urmărite la organizarea unei baze de date:

1. Organizarea intrărilor de date, se referă la:

- sursa datelor (documente primite, fişiere etc.);

- actualizarea datelor (moduri, momente, reorganizări etc.);

- controlul intrărilor de date (natură, conţinut, format, periodicitate etc.).

2. Organizarea memorării datelor, se referă la:

- principii de memorare (memoria internă/externă, forma de stocare, legături între date, tehnici utilizate etc.);

- optimizarea memorării (redundanţă, spaţiu, alocare, codificare, reorganizare etc.).

3. Organizarea protecţiei datelor sub cele două aspecte (securitatea şi integritatea), se referă la:

- instrumente oferite de către SGBD (autorizare acces, fişiere jurnal, arhivări etc.);

- metode proprii (parole, rutine speciale, antivirus etc.).

4. Organizarea legăturilor bazei de date cu alte aplicaţii, se referă la: conversii, standarde, compatibilităţii, interfeţe etc.

3.2. Obiectivele urmărite la realizarea unei BD

Atunci când dorim să realizăm o bază de dată trebuie să ştim clar ce avem de făcut, adică să stabilim obiectivele activităţii nostre. În acest sens, câteva dintre cele mai importante obiective, le prezentaăm în continuare. Acestea, ar trebui să constituie un set minim de obiective, de care să se ţină cont la realizarea unei baze de date.

1. Partiţionarea semnifică faptul că aceleaşi date trebuie să poată fi folosite în moduri diferite de către diferiţi utilizatori.

2. Deschiderea se referă la faptul că datele trebuie să fie uşor adaptabile la schimbările care pot apărea (actualizarea structurii, tipuri noi de date etc.).

3. Eficienţa are în vedere stocarea şi prelucrarea datelor, care trebuie să se facă la costuri cât mai scăzute, costuri care să fie inferioare beneficiilor obţinute.

4. Reutilizarea înseamnă faptul că fondul de date existent trebuie să poată fi reutilizat în diferite aplicaţii informatice.

5. Regăsirea este o actvitate frecventă pe bazele de date şi de aceea cererile de regăsire trebuie să poată fi adresate uşor de către toate categoriile de utilizatori, după diferite criterii.

6. Accesul înseamnă modul de localizare a datelor şi acest lucru trebuie să poată fi realizat prin diferite moduri de acces, rapid şi uşor.

7. Modularizarea presupune faptul că realizarea BD trebuie să se poată face modular pentru generalitate şi posibilitatea lucrului în echipă.

8. Protecţia bazei de date trebuie asigurată sub ambele aspecte: securitatea şi integritatea datelor.

9. Redundanţa se asigură în limite acceptabile prin implementarea unui model de date pentru baze de date şi prin utilizarea unei tehnici de proiectare a BD. Se asigură astfel, o redundanţă minimă şi controlată.

10. Independenţa datelor faţă de programe trebuie asigurată atât la nivel logic cât şi şi fizic.

3.3. Etape în realizarea unei BD

Spuneam la începutul acestei cărţi, că bazele de date au evoluat ca un tip special de sisteme informatice, şi anume cele care au organizarea datelor în memoria externă conform unui model de date specific. De aceea, în metodologia de realizare a BD se parcurg, în cea mai mare parte, cam aceleaşi etape ca la realizarea unui sistem informatic, cu o serie de aspecte specifice. Pe de altă parte, în literatura de specialitate [RAGE00], sunt diferite propuneri de metodologii de realizare a bazelor de date.

Ţinând cont de cele două aspecte de mai sus, autorii propun câteva actvivităţi care trebuie parcurse la realizarea unei baze de date. Aceste activităţi vor fi regăsite, sub aceeaşi denumire sau sub denumiri diferite, în majoritatea metodologiilor de realizare a bazelor de date, din literatura de specialitate.

Activităţile (etapele) parcurse pentru realizarea unei BD (fig. 3.1.) sunt: analiza de sistem, proiectarea noului sistem, realizarea componentelor logice, punerea în funcţiune, dezvoltarea.

Preview document

Metodologia de realizare a bazelor de date - Pagina 1
Metodologia de realizare a bazelor de date - Pagina 2
Metodologia de realizare a bazelor de date - Pagina 3
Metodologia de realizare a bazelor de date - Pagina 4
Metodologia de realizare a bazelor de date - Pagina 5
Metodologia de realizare a bazelor de date - Pagina 6
Metodologia de realizare a bazelor de date - Pagina 7
Metodologia de realizare a bazelor de date - Pagina 8
Metodologia de realizare a bazelor de date - Pagina 9
Metodologia de realizare a bazelor de date - Pagina 10
Metodologia de realizare a bazelor de date - Pagina 11
Metodologia de realizare a bazelor de date - Pagina 12
Metodologia de realizare a bazelor de date - Pagina 13

Conținut arhivă zip

  • Metodologia de Realizare a Bazelor de Date.doc

Alții au mai descărcat și

Sistem Informatic privind Evidența Resurselor Umane la Întreprindere

INTRODUCERE În perioada de tranziţie la economia de piaţă o importanţă deosebită capătă automatizarea proceselor de prelucrare a informaţiei....

Proiectarea unui sistem informatic - agenție de transport persoane

1.Descrierea problemei Societatea „TransEurope SRL” are ca obiect de activitate transportul international de persoane cu autocarul.Pentru...

Catalog Virtual

I. JUSTIFICAREA TEMEI Odată cu extinderea atribuţiilor ce revin diriginţilor în ce priveşte urmărirea evoluţiei elevilor din clasa pe care o...

Proiect informatică - fișiere text

1.Fişiere 1.1.Noţiuni introductive Un fişier este o colecţie de date de acelaşi tip, memorate pe suport extern (hard-disc, dischetă, CD etc)....

Matrice

Matrice (tablou bidimensional) Matricea este un tip de data la care elementele sunt asezate pe linii si pe coloane. Un element se identifica...

Plan de măsuri TIC

Ministerul Comunicaţiilor şi Tehnologiei Informaţiei realizează politicile şi strategiile în domeniul comunicaţiilor şi tehnologiei informaţiei,...

Baze de Date

Cap. I ELEMENTE DE TEORIA BAZELOR DE DATE 1.1 Scopul şi obiectivele organizării datelor Organizarea datelor ocupă un loc important în proiectarea...

Baze de Date pentru Anul IV Inginerie Economică

2. Sistemul MS – Access de gestionare de baze de date Obiectivele acestui modul sunt: - Cunoasterea sistemului de gestionare de baze de date...

Te-ar putea interesa și

Subsistem Informatic privind Evidența Tranzacțiilor Rutiere la Firma de Transport

Introducere Progresul tehnico-economic la etapa actuală cuprinde o sferă din ce în ce mai largă a activităţii umane, influienţînd deci şi modul în...

Monitorizarea activității unei firme de transport

Introducere Progresul tehnico-economic în etapa zilelor noastre, cuprinde o paletă din ce în ce mai mare a activităţii oamenilor, în concluzie...

Sistem Informatic privind Activitatea Financiară de Asigurare

Introducere Trebuie să ne asumăm riscul de a ne asigura? Iată o întrebare care, deşi are semnificaţii practice remarcabile şi atinge unul din...

Subsistemul Informatic privind Proiectarea și Elaborarea Complexului Program în Domeniul Construcțiilor

Introducere Proiectarea sistemelor informatice constituie o activitate complexă care, presupune îmbinarea strânsă a cunoştinţelor economice de...

Cunoaștere și Învățare Eficientă

1. CUNOASTERE SI ÎNVATARE EFICIENTA Obiective vizate: § sa defineasca conceptul/categoria de cunoastere; § sa diferentieze si sa coreleze...

Subsistem Informatic Privind Evidența Contractelor de Asigurări ale Culturilor Agricole

Introducere Din vremuri imemoriale, vieţile şi bunurile oamenilor au fost ameninţate de cele mai variate şi distructive forţe ale naturii....

Deșeurile Medicale

Deseurile medicale includ toate deseurile generate de institutiile sanitare, institutele de cercetare si laboratoare. In plus, aceastea includ...

Reciclarea Deșeurilor

CAP.1 INTRODUCERE CAP.1 GESTIONAREA DESEURILOR REZULTATE DIN INSTITUTII MEDICALE 2.1. LEGISLATIA PRIVIND GESTIONAREA DESEURILOR REZULTATE DIN...

Ai nevoie de altceva?